Note that the old stainless steel track is not the same as the current legacy track. The old stainless steel track would have needed much less cleaning, but would be extremely difficult to solder. The current track is very similar to other track (nickel silver) and thus should need cleaning approximately the same amount as any other nickel silver track. It is possible that a higher nickel content may retard speed of oxidation. It might be worthwhile making a controlled test between Legacy track and Peco track.

On my helix, an oval with a 2.5% ruling grade and radius 4 outer (up) track, I installed the Powerbase pieces and held the track on as did you, with screws in the middle.. I added the powerbase magnets to my Scotsman, first using BlakTak - big mistake! The magnets ripped off by the third screw and derailed everything. Second try, with the magnets installed using the packaging per the instructions, not problem staying on the loco, but I did experience many slowdowns as the loco passed over the screws. After a lot of work, the screws were gone, and the track is now held down with TINY 10mm screws, mostly through the outside sleepers (but some in the middle), and no problem. I can now pull an eight coach train easily. Note: I had the room to add an 18" tangent after each 180 degrees so I could achieve enough clearance to get my clumsy mitts in for re-railing or cleaning. Also, the baseboard has had the center cut out to a 30" diameter so I can get inside for wiring and maintenance. On a second line on my layout, a 4% incline up to a mine site for a shunter and six or so wagons, I put the powerbase on with CopyDex, and attached the track with CopyDex with NO problems.
